Compliance Executive
QHSE Taskforce

About the job

This is an excellent opportunity to be part of a very successful and growing business in the North East. In this role, you will provide an all-around assurance and compliance administrative function, in support to the quality assurance and compliance throughout the business. Responsibilities: * Assist the compliance function to implement and continuously assess for improvement. * Assist and take part the adoption of an internal peer to peer led audit regime that enhances service delivery and contract compliance. * Work with the Quality Assurance Manager and Chief Financial Officer to continuously review policies and procedures to ensure both compliance with legal requirements and best practice (for example relating to data protection, anti-bribery, and record retention). * Support the design, implementation and continuous improvement of internal quality control and assurance methods which promote brilliance in all aspects of the business. * Maintain the risk/difficulties registers, master lists of our Policies, Terms & Conditions and Compliance training etc across the business. * Refining, contributing, and promoting a culture of continuous improvement to continuously improve and enhance our Quality Assurance Framework. * Coordination and facilitation of internal and external quality and compliance audits * Project compliance coordination such as document retention and archiving. * Provide confidential administrative support to the Compliance team. * Involvement in day-to-day reporting within the Assurance and Compliance function, and record management. * Keeping up to date with changes with our External accreditations such as ISO. Requirements: * Relevant experience in an audit, quality, documentation, or project management coordinator/ administration role * A basic understanding of external accreditations (such as ISO). * Excellent communication skills. * Enjoys working within a dynamic and fast paced environment, and is the go-to person for Compliance queries. * Exceptional attention to detail and analytical skills. * ICT literacy with competence Microsoft Office suite. * Able to demonstrate an understanding of business processes and identify scope for improvement. * Ability to self-motivate and complete training courses to upskill where appropriate
